I researched this a bit, and it seems like the only dyes are spray on, and you can get them from Napa or Sherwin Williams auto paint supply places. Doesn't sound like a fun process to me, but sounds like it works better than paint. I read a lot of posts on some messageboard, and all the guys that said they used paint were so pissed they used paint.
